In this Learnscape, the Student is the Manager of the Health Information Management Department for a hospital. Several times in recent weeks, the Electronic Health Records Implementation Manager, Brianne Carlson, has mentioned that the backlog of work was growing and that she needed more help. She has never been more specific than simply saying that “more help” was needed, and her complaints seemed to be no more than passing remarks offered without preparation or forethought. Since the Student has been under pressure from a number of directions including threats of impending budget cuts the Student has not felt compelled to add the scanning backlog to their list of active worries. Our Learnscape opens with the Student’s mentor introducing the role and situation. Then, out of nowhere, the Electronic Health Records Implementation Manager, Brianne Carlson, drops her bomb. “I need one more full-time electronic medical records scanner and I need her now. If something isn’t done about it by Friday, you can find yourself a new implementation manager.” In the subsequent scenes, the Student will discuss with their mentor possible solutions and potential advantages and disadvantages of each. They will discuss the trap the student is now in and explain why it is a trap. The Student will then be allowed to see, by trial and error, the affects of pursuing different solutions, including calling the supervisor’s bluff, requiring a documented request, and even giving in to the ultimatum. By the end, the Student will realize that they need to address the general condition that caused the specific problem in the first case. Characters: 1. Kailee Pierson: HR Manager 2. Brianne Carlson: EHR Implementation Manager
